Obstructive Sleep Apnea exists when your upper airway tissues in your throat drop down and restrict or stop you from breathing for long periods of time when you sleep. An individual suffering from obstructive sleep apnea can experience hundreds -- even thousands -- of episodes in the course of one night. The body usually doesn't awaken, and people don't often remember not breathing, even though it happened lots of times. The body doesn't receive valuable oxygen; it is basically being suffocated during sleep, night after night. Due to the continuous nighttime breathing interruptions, patients will generally start to experience several symptoms which are directly caused by sleep apnea.
